Pressure Sensing Fabric

Summary
Existing pressure sensing fabrics may involve two portions, i.e., insulating and conductive portions in the fabric, which increases the complexity of the fabric system and more important, and the instablization of the resistance-strain relationship during dynamic deformation which limits the application fields due to intrinsic properties difference between the two portions. These fabrics commonly employ two or more layers to accomplish the detecting functions. Such arrangements increase the thickness, weight, and cost of the sensors with some other disadvantages such as low accuracy, instability, etc. This invention describes a pressure sensing fabric have a general structure as simple as a plurality of electrically conducting yarns forming interlocking loops of yarns. The pressure sensing fabric is found not only be able to sense pressure but also the magnitude of the pressure

Summary: The pressure or strain/position sensing fabric is useful in furniture, apparel, composites for vehicles, landscape, dams, highways, and buildings. It is used as resistive strain sensors for single points or distributed pressure measurements utilizing their changes in the electrical resistance under mechanical deformations. It is used to measure deformation caused by lateral compression or tensile force in the plane of the fabric. It can also be used as pressure (tactile) mapping sensor measuring both the position of the applied force and its magnitude simultaneously. It is used in industry testing fields such as strain gauges.
Novelty: Pressure or strain/position sensing fabric useful in furniture, apparel, composites for vehicles, landscape, dams, highways, and buildings, includes electrically conducting yarn(s) forming interlocking rings
